What Defines Trap Anime Characters?

Trap anime characters are defined by their ability to present as a different gender than their biological sex. This can manifest in various ways, such as clothing, mannerisms, and overall presentation. Here are some common traits of trap anime characters:

  • Androgynous appearance
  • Feminine or masculine clothing choices
  • Unique personality traits that challenge traditional gender roles
  • Often involved in comedic or romantic scenarios

Are Trap Anime Characters Just for Comedy?

While many trap characters are used for comedic purposes, their roles often extend beyond mere humor. They can serve as critical commentary on societal norms and expectations surrounding gender. By presenting characters that defy conventional gender roles, writers can challenge the audience’s perceptions and stimulate discussions about identity and acceptance.

How Are Trap Anime Characters Portrayed in Different Genres?

Trap anime characters can be found across a variety of genres, each with its unique take on gender expression. Here’s how they are typically portrayed in different genres:

  • Romance: Often as love interests, challenging traditional dating norms.
  • Comedy: Their gender presentation is often played for laughs, creating humorous situations.
  • Action: Characters may use their gender-bending traits to deceive enemies or gain an advantage in battles.
  • Slice of Life: These characters may explore themes of self-identity and acceptance in everyday scenarios.

What Are the Criticisms of Trap Anime Characters?

Despite their popularity, trap anime characters are not without controversy. Critics argue that their portrayal can sometimes reinforce stereotypes or trivialize serious discussions about gender identity. Here are some common criticisms:

  • Objectification: Some characters may be overly sexualized, reducing them to mere entertainment.
  • Reinforcement of Stereotypes: The representation may lean on clichés, leading to misrepresentations of gender fluidity.
  • Lack of Depth: Some trap characters are not given sufficient backstory or development, making them one-dimensional.
